One popular DIY vegan face scrub recipe is made from just two ingredients: coffee grounds and coconut oil. Coffee grounds act as an exfoliant, removing dead skin cells and leaving your skin feeling soft and smooth. Meanwhile, coconut oil provides hydration and nourishment to the skin. Simply mix equal parts coffee grounds and melted coconut oil together, gently massage onto your face in circular motions for a few minutes, then rinse off with warm water.

For those with sensitive skin, it’s important to choose gentle yet effective vegan face scrubs that won’t cause irritation or redness. Look for products that use mild exfoliants such as oatmeal or sugar. Oatmeal acts as a soothing agent while gently sloughing away dead skin cells, making it perfect for sensitive skin types. To create an easy oatmeal-based vegan face scrub, combine ground oats with a little bit of almond milk until it forms a paste-like consistency. Massage onto damp skin using gentle circular motions before rinsing off thoroughly.

When searching for cruelty-free exfoliating ingredients in face scrubs, opt for natural options like fruit enzymes or jojoba beads instead of microbeads which harm marine life when washed down the drain. Fruit enzymes such as papaya or pineapple contain alpha-hydroxy acids (AHAs) that help break down dead skin cells without causing any damage to the environment. Jojoba beads are biodegradable alternatives to plastic microbeads found in many conventional scrubs.

People with acne-prone skin need extra care when choosing vegan face scrubs to avoid exacerbating their condition. Tea tree oil is a popular ingredient known for its antibacterial properties, making it an excellent choice for acne-prone skin. Combine a few drops of tea tree oil with aloe vera gel and sugar to create an effective vegan face scrub that helps fight bacteria while gently exfoliating the skin.

To maximize the effectiveness of your vegan face scrub, it’s important to follow proper exfoliation techniques. Start with clean, damp skin and use gentle circular motions when massaging the scrub onto your face. Avoid applying too much pressure as this can cause irritation. Rinse off thoroughly with warm water and follow up with a moisturizer to lock in hydration.

Depending on climate or weather conditions, you may need to adjust your skincare routine accordingly. For hot and humid climates, opt for lightweight vegan face scrubs with oil-balancing ingredients like witch hazel or citrus extracts. In colder or drier climates, choose thicker formulas enriched with hydrating oils like argan or avocado to combat dryness.

Properly storing homemade vegan face scrubs is essential to maintain their freshness and efficacy. Store them in airtight containers away from direct sunlight or excessive heat to prevent spoilage.
